mysql不支持中文全文索引,你在建站中是怎么解决全文搜索的?mysql

解决方案 »

  1.   

    尽量不用mysql去做全文索引~~~
    如果需要大量搜索的话,建议通过 coreseek 来辅助实现
      

  2.   


    搜索这种事,交给lucene 吧
      

  3.   

    rawurlencode() 插入,搜索
    rawurldecode() 显示str_replace('%20',' ',rawurlencode($str));
      

  4.   


    搜索这种事,交给lucene 吧
    ElasticSearch?HubbleDotNet怎么样?
      

  5.   


    搜索这种事,交给lucene 吧
    ElasticSearch?HubbleDotNet怎么样?还是做点靠谱的事吧
      

  6.   


    搜索这种事,交给lucene 吧
    ElasticSearch?HubbleDotNet怎么样?还是做点靠谱的事吧
    搜索这功能必须有啊
      

  7.   


    搜索这种事,交给lucene 吧
    ElasticSearch?HubbleDotNet怎么样?还是做点靠谱的事吧
    搜索这功能必须有啊
    就像上面说的啊,看你的需求,你要是非常庞大的业务搜索,那就用lucene。要是业务小,就简单点sphinx就好了。
      

  8.   

    lucene、ElasticSearch,比较适合超级规模的项目,中小型性能不怎么样。
    HubbleDotNet缺皮少毛。再就是,对开源数据库支持的重视程度好像比较不太优先。
    coreseek/斯芬克斯,典型的开源产品,功能不全,build特点明显。放弃了。